1 sticker costs $2.
1 box of 40 stickers costs $10.
Adam needs 85 stickers.
- What is the minimum number of boxs that Adam should buy?
- How much will Adam spend?
(a)
Sets of 40 stickers
= 85 ÷ 40
= 2 r 5
Amount that Adam has to spend to buy 5 stickers
= 5 x 2
= $10
To buy 5 stickers at $10 is more expensive than 40 stickers at $10.
Minimum number of boxs that Adam has to buy
= 2 + 1
= 3
(b)
Amount that Adam has to spend on 3 boxs
= 3 x 10
= $30
Answer(s): (a) 3; (b) $30
